Summary

The Product Delivery Coordinator supports the CLIENT's Product Delivery Manager in deploying Zoom & Polycom Phone products to the CLIENT's Retail Branch nationwide estate. The role involves tracking project deliverables, updating status, manipulating spreadsheets, and providing metrics and reporting.

Primary Duties

  • Track project deliverables related to the implementation of Zoom phone at each branch
  • Update the status of deliverables in a centralized repository
  • Manipulate spreadsheets, including those used as data input for Zoom implementations
  • Upload spreadsheets and submit webforms into a centralized repository
  • Participate in various project meetings and assist the Product Delivery Manager by recording meeting minutes
  • Quality-assure data sets to ensure accuracy / data integrity
  • Provide routine metrics and reporting on Zoom
